Warren Central runs to second
straight 5A state championship ·
Warriors connect on state
finals record 99-yard pass play in first quarter ·
Snider’s Andrew Gregory garners
Eskew Mental Attitude Award |

Roncalli claims record eighth championship and 18th
straight post-season win ·
Third straight 4A title for
Rebels also secures sixth crown for coach Bruce Scifres ·
Wawasee’s Kory Lantz selected as Eskew Mental Attitude Award winner |

Andrean upsets top-ranked Heritage Hills; wins first state
football title ·
Andrean QB Tommy Finn runs for 95 yards, 2 TDs,
throws for another ·
Heritage Hills’ Bryce Pund named Eskew Mental
Attitude Award recipient |

Tri-West soph
QB Tyler Bruce passes for 3 TDs, runs for 2 as
Bruins defend title ·
Eastbrook’s Rob Bragg selected as Eskew
Mental Attitude Award winner |

Seeger grabs four Ritter turnovers to win first state title in
any sport ·
Ritter’s Spencer King named Eskew Mental Attitude Award winner |
